Quick Facts — Howard village

What is the median household income in Howard village?
The median household income in Howard village is $84,896 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in Howard village?
The poverty rate in Howard village is 3.7%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the median home value in Howard village?
$286,200 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in Howard village?
The median gross rent in Howard village is $1,053 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of Howard village residents have a college degree?
34.9% of adults in Howard village h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
